What Are Mini-Courses for Teachers?

Mini-courses are short, focused professional development programs designed to help teachers acquire new skills quickly. Unlike traditional semester-long courses, these are condensed into a few hours or weeks, making them ideal for busy educators.

Key Features of Mini-Courses:

  • Short Duration (1 hour to 4 weeks)
  • Focused Topics (e.g., EdTech tools, inclusive teaching, gamification)
  • Flexible Learning (self-paced or live sessions)
  • Practical Applications (immediate classroom implementation)

Benefits of Mini-Courses for Professional Development

Teachers face time constraints, making lengthy certifications impractical. Mini-courses offer:

A. Time Efficiency

  • Learn new skills without long-term commitments.
  • Ideal for summer breaks or weekend upskilling.

B. Cost-Effectiveness

  • Affordable compared to full-degree programs.
  • Many institutions offer free or low-cost options.

C. Personalized Learning

  • Choose courses aligned with your teaching goals.
  • Focus on niche areas like STEM, SEL, or hybrid teaching.

D. Immediate Classroom Impact

  • Apply strategies right away for better student engagement.

Latest Trends in Teacher Mini-Courses (2024)

The educational landscape is shifting, and mini-courses are adapting to new demands.

A. AI and EdTech Integration

  • Courses on ChatGPT for lesson planning.
  • Using VR/AR in classrooms.

B. Social-Emotional Learning (SEL)

  • Managing student anxiety and mental health.
  • Building inclusive classrooms.

C. Micro-Credentials & Badges

  • Digital certifications to showcase expertise.
  • Stackable credentials for career advancement.

D. Hybrid Teaching Strategies

  • Blending in-person and online instruction effectively.

How to Choose the Right Mini-Course for Your Needs?

With so many options, selecting the best course can be tricky. Consider:

✅ Your Teaching Goals (Tech skills? Classroom management?)
✅ Course Format (Self-paced vs. instructor-led)
✅ Accreditation & Reviews (Check credibility)
✅ Time Commitment (Match with your schedule)
